Geological Summary |
The claims are underlain by Jurassic Rossland Group volcanics. Mineralization consists of veins of massive pyrrhotite and chalcopyrite with minor pyrite and arsenopyrite, often with good gold values. Fracture zones of unknown extent contains the same mineralization occurring as disseminations.
